THIS IS A NATIONAL GUARD TITLE 32 EXCEPTED SERVICE POSITION. This National Guard position is for a PHOTOGRAPHER (TITLE 32), Position Description Number D1591000 and is part of the NCNG PAO, National Guard (JFHQ-PAO / MD 1210-405).

Duties

As a PHOTOGRAPHER, GS-1060-09, you will plan the visual aspects of publications, exhibits, or presentations utilizing specialized photographic & audio/video equipment, techniques and processes to develop, modify and enhance the final product; advise and assist in scripting, story boarding and visualizing the art needed in the finished product; videotape events and staged performances needed to produce videos requested by the units of this command; review the script with the director prior to videotaping to define the production's photographic and stylistic requirements; the incumbent uses this understanding of the director's intentions to deviate from the script and take additional field shots that will facilitate editing, capture interesting scenes that were not anticipated, and minimize distracting audio and visual elements; assure that lighting and audio levels are such that they will enhance the finished product edit, revise and polish raw footage into a finished presentation; also perform video documentation using his/her own initiative in determining what scenes are necessary to establish the main facts, accurately represent the event, and place it in proper context; photograph/Film required visuals in order to complete needed project; select photos/film clips needed to edit and complete the project; photograph and control processing of digital and still photographs as well as HD video needed for ceremonies, training events, promotions, Chain of Command display, news releases and morale and welfare events; perform precise photographic operations with electronically timed high-speed cameras and exposures; coordinate equipment and lighting needs to capture desired images; use subject matter knowledge to anticipate the various stages in the procedure and to recognize points of interest; based on familiarity with subject matter and content, discusses general requirements of what is to be photographed with requester; plan the photographic recording and determination of suitable methods of illumination, camera placement, and general sequence of actions or operations for sequence shots; determine the need for change or alterations in the setting of the event while maintaining the flexibility to adjust to limitations; exercise extensive artistic ability in selecting scenes/events that will carry out required photo objectives; use digital cameras and processes related to their function, manipulation, and products; is accountable for the security of all issued equipment, supplies, and materials; adapt or alter equipment to meet existing situations and to improvise to compensate for faulty equipment, i.e., calibrates color balance, exposure, and contrast on slide duplicator to accommodate for machine variance and changes in film emulsion in order to avoid lengthy and costly repairs by manufacturer; perform operator maintenance of cameras and other photographic equipment up to standard; perform silver recovery operations in accordance with existing policies, regulations, and directives; task include disassembly, cleaning, lubricating, adjusting, and making minor repairs; maintenance records are to document all work performed on equipment; follows all safety procedures and reports unsafe conditions as required; involves the taking of still photographs or HD video for the documentation of events, training or educational purposes; thorough understanding of the capabilities and limitations of specialized photographic equipment, film and processing; skill in adjusting equipment to withstand physical stress and accommodate special wiring requirements; thorough understanding roles of a HD videographer during events and staged performances and the ability to produce videos, PSAs, BLOGS requested by the units of this command and able to support NCNG Social Media platforms.

Qualifications

MILITARY GRADES: Enlisted ( E5 to E8) MINIMUM RQUIREMENTS: Experience, education, or training performing work in operating still, television (video), or motion picture cameras, and in processing photographic film and negatives. Knowledge of equipment, techniques, and processes of photography, knowledge of subject matter to be photographed, and/or selecting, arranging, and lighting subjects or in processing work. Experience using computer and automation systems. SPECIALIZED EXPERIENCE: (Must have at least 24 months of experience), education, or training utilizing still and motion, ultra high speed and stop still photographic camera equipment. Experience developing, modifying, or adapting equipment and procedures to meet new requirements or to perform assignments involving unusual or unprecedented situations that require photographic treatment. Experience designing and creating special affects to meet the requirements of a project. Substitution of Education for Specialized Experience: 4 years above high school leading to a bachelor's degree with major study or 24 semester hours of course work in a related field for GS-05 positions. Education (for positions at GS-5: Major study -- photography, or other fields related to the position.
